Monde Nissin Corp. is keen on forging partnerships for coconut growing to support the production of its new product, according to the Philippine Coconut Authority .
PCA said Monde Nissin would require a steady supply of coconuts for its new product, Goodnom Fresh Gata. The discussion also extended to the company’s pursuit of sustainable energy sources, particularly biofuels derived from coconuts. Buted welcomed this commitment and suggested involving other agencies implementing the Coconut Farmers and Industry Development Plan to widen the scope and impact of these efforts.
The agency said both parties would have another meeting, which will include Monde Nissin’s Research and Development and procurement teams to deepen the collaboration.
